Detailed Description
# TANK DIMENSIONS: (L)24" x (W)20" x (H)20".
# 150w 14,000k with 2 x 24w Actinics supplements
# 2 LED-HO 2 watt moonlights.
# Full size direct-skim refugium on back. Does not include refugium substrate.
# Comes in black Cell-Cast acrylic background.
# Refugium Dimensions (L)23" x (W)5" x (H)19.5".
# PC light strip for refugium.
# Signature Polished and mitred edges with Extra thick 8mm thick glass.
# Seamless curved front panel.
# Professional light weight slim profile HQI, T5HO, LED-HO 3-in-1 lighting system.
# separate circuits and switches for complete automatic and manual control for each T5 bulb, LED-HO system and Halide lights.
# 100G Professional pin-wheel protein skimmer with silencer and Ozone adapter.

i know that you know that i know that i LOVE your tank :) is it getting toooooo small already??? hey meant to ask you what to do you feed your zoas, or what additives do you add???
 
i know that you know that i know that i LOVE your tank :) is it getting toooooo small already??? hey meant to ask you what to do you feed your zoas, or what additives do you add???

i feed my tank mix of cyclopeeze,rods food and mysis shrimp then i add a few drops of amino omega...some zoas react to food some not...they get cyclopeeze some eat a whole mysis...

2 part,mag,iodine,vit c and amino acids....
